The final amount for your new floors depends on a few specific things. First, it comes down to the material you choose, whether that is hardwood, luxury vinyl, or carpet. The size of the area being covered and how much prep work the subfloor needs will also play a role. If your rooms have complex layouts or lots of corners, that often adds labor time. The 1 3 rule in flooring often refers to a guideline for calculating material needs, accounting for waste during cuts. It helps ensure you have enough material for your project. The specialists can apply this to your Aurora flooring job.
Both vinyl plank and laminate are popular choices for Aurora homes. Vinyl plank typically offers better moisture resistance, making it suitable for kitchens and bathrooms. Laminate can provide superior scratch resistance. The pros can help you decide based on your priorities.
